Abstract: Public school teachers throughout the United States are seeing their classrooms filled with
linguistically diverse students. According to the literature, this shift in linguistic diversification has served as a
motivator to conduct research of the multilingual classroom. However, the experiences of secondary teachers'
challenges regarding the education of ELLs has received little research attention. The increase in linguistic
diversity impacts the educational scene of the nation's secondary schools. Thus, a study on secondary
teachers' experiences with ELLs is warranted.
Despite the myriad of professional development activities designed to help mainstream teachers educate
English language learners (ELLs) teachers continue to face challenges associated with helping these students
realize academic achievement. The expected increase in 15 million ELLs (predicted to double by the year 2015)
in the k-12 public education system will require an adjustment in the methods used among educators and
policymakers to best educate the students.
This study will both identify and explore the challenges that junior high school teachers encounter in the
education process of ELLs. The researcher will set out to ask teachers about their greatest challenges with
regard to educating ELLs and analyze how these challenges vary among the junior high school teachers. A
mixed-method approach to the study will be used in determining the findings of the study. The study participants
will complete a fifteen item Likert scale survey adapted from the Preparedness to Teach ELLs Survey
formulated by Lucas, Villegas and Reznitskaya. Following the completion of the survey a sample of the teachers
will participate in structured focus interviews stratified by the teaching departments of the school. These
interviews will feature open ended questions related to the challenges of teaching ELLs. The findings will help
school administrators and educational policy makers in prescribing the type of professional development that
will assist the teaching population and ultimately aid in the academic achievement of the ELLs.
